The sore or lesion that develops on the lining of the stomach is called a stomach ulcer, or gastric ulcer. Many things can bring it on, like being sick with Helicobacter pylori, taking NSAIDs for too long, drinking too much, or being under too much stress. It is common practice to combine medical treatment with behavioral modifications, such as following a prescribed diet, in the management of stomach ulcers. In order to alleviate stomach ulcer symptoms, regulate acid production, and speed up the healing process, a special diet is prescribed. Although specific dietary advice may differ for each person, those who suffer from stomach ulcers should be aware of the following general guidelines: - Meals with Low Acidity: Eating meals with low acidity can help keep the stomach lining from getting irritated. To that end, it's best to stay away from more acidic fruits like tomatoes and citrus fruits and go for softer ones like bananas and melons. - Lean Proteins: Instead of fatty or overly processed meats, opt for skinless fowl, fish, tofu, or lentils as your protein source. This can help ease gastrointestinal issues. - Complete Grains: You can get all the nutrients and fiber you need from whole grains like brown rice, quinoa, and whole wheat without worrying too much about bloating or gas. - Choose Healthy Fats: If you're looking for a way to make your digestive system happier, try using avocados and olive oil instead of saturated or trans fats. - Dairy Goods Because high-fat dairy can encourage the production of stomach acid, people with stomach ulcers may benefit from choosing low-fat or fat-free dairy products. - Spices and hot meals might make stomach ulcer symptoms worse for some people, therefore it's best to limit their intake of these. 6. Lessening or doing away with them entirely from the diet could be helpful. - Eat Smaller Meals More Frequently: Instead of three big meals, try eating smaller meals throughout the day. This will help control stomach acid production and alleviate discomfort. - Staying Away from meals That Set Off Symptoms: It's vital to figure out what meals or drinks bring on your symptoms and try to avoid them. Caffeine, alcoholic beverages, chocolate, and carbonated beverages are common stimulants. Always consult your doctor or a certified nutritionist to develop a unique stomach ulcer diet plan that takes into account your specific requirements and health history, as dietary reactions might differ from person to person. To get the most out of your healthcare provider-prescribed medication for ulcers, be sure that any dietary adjustments you make work in conjunction with it.
